结论:腾讯云轻量应用服务器支持用户自行安装软件,但需注意系统环境和权限配置。
轻量应用服务器是否能自己安装软件?
腾讯云的轻量应用服务器(TencentCloud Lighthouse)是一种面向个人开发者、中小企业和学生用户的轻量级云计算产品。它简化了云服务器的使用流程,让用户能够快速部署和管理应用。然而,很多用户关心的问题是:轻量应用服务器能否像普通云服务器一样自由安装软件?
答案是肯定的——轻量应用服务器允许用户自行安装软件。
为什么可以安装软件?
-
基于Linux或Windows系统的完整操作系统环境
- 轻量应用服务器默认提供多种操作系统镜像,包括主流的Linux发行版(如CentOS、Ubuntu)以及Windows Server。
- 这些系统具有完整的文件系统和执行权限,支持用户通过命令行或远程桌面进行自定义操作。
-
具备root或管理员权限
- 用户可以通过SSH连接Linux服务器,或者通过远程桌面登录Windows实例,并拥有相应的管理权限。
- 这意味着你可以自由安装各类软件、配置服务、修改系统设置等。
-
开放端口与网络访问控制
- 腾讯云提供了防火墙规则配置功能,用户可以根据需要开放特定端口,从而运行Web服务、数据库、API接口等应用程序。
安装软件时需要注意哪些问题?
虽然可以安装软件,但在实际操作中仍需注意以下几点:
-
系统资源限制
- 轻量服务器通常配置较低(例如1核2G、2核4G),在安装资源占用较大的软件(如MySQL、Docker、Redis)时,需考虑性能瓶颈。
-
镜像版本选择
- 某些预置的应用镜像可能已经集成了特定软件栈,如果重复安装可能导致冲突。
- 建议选择“纯净”的操作系统镜像进行自定义安装。
-
安全与权限管理
- 开放不必要的端口或随意提升权限可能会带来安全隐患。
- 建议遵循最小权限原则,合理配置防火墙和用户权限。
-
数据持久化与备份
- 系统盘为云硬盘,数据相对安全,但仍建议定期备份重要配置和数据。
实际应用场景举例
-
搭建个人博客/网站
- 可以安装LNMP(Linux + Nginx + MySQL + PHP)环境,部署WordPress或其他CMS系统。
-
开发测试环境
- 安装Node.js、Python、Java等开发环境,用于本地代码的远程调试和测试。
-
运行小型数据库或缓存服务
- 如Redis、MongoDB等,适用于轻量级项目的数据处理需求。
-
部署自动化工具
- 安装Docker、Jenkins等工具,实现CI/CD流程或定时任务自动化。
总结
腾讯云轻量应用服务器不仅支持用户自行安装软件,还具备灵活的操作系统环境和管理权限。 对于希望快速上手云计算、进行学习或部署轻量级项目的用户来说,是一个性价比高且功能全面的选择。只要合理规划资源与权限,就能充分发挥其潜力,满足多样化的应用需求。
云知道CLOUD